Jane Addams called the impulse to found settlement houses:

Christian humanitarianism

Of the four presidential candidates in 1912, the one most likely to advocate government ownership of big business was:

Eugene V. Debs

Theodore Roosevelt initiated more anti-trust suits than any president in history.

False

During the coal strike of 1902:

President Theodore Roosevelt won support for his use of the "big stick" against corporations

The major forces behind the social gospel movement were:

Protestants and Catholics

As a result of the Brownsville Riot in 1906:

Roosevelt discharged the entire regiment of African American soldiers

Ida M. Tarbell is best known for her investigation of:

Standard Oil

The title of the novel that described the terrible conditions of the meat-packing industry was:

The Jungle

Which candidate was shot during the 1912 presidential campaign?

Theodore Roosevelt

Booker T. Washington was the most prominent black leader in the early twentieth century.

True

Woodrow Wilson was a minister's son who grew up in the South

True

among the varied sources of progressivism were populism and the Mugwumps.

True

Of the following, who eventually became chief justice of the Supreme Court?

William Howard Taft

The Seventeenth Amendment:

authorized the popular election of U.S. senators

The muckrakers saw their primary objective as:

exposing social problems to the public

The National Child Labor Committee pushed:

for laws prohibiting the employment of young children

During the Progressive Era:

many groups—blacks, the poor, the unorganized—had little influence

In 1917, a Prohibition amendment to the Constitution:

passed Congress, then went to the states for ratification

As president, Taft:

preserved more public lands in four years than Roosevelt had in nearly eight

Woodrow Wilson's New Freedom platform:

proposed vigorous anti-trust action to break up corporate concentration

Despite Josephus Daniels's racist views, President Wilson still nominated Daniels for:

secretary of the navy

Elizabeth Cady Stanton is associated with:

the National Woman Suffrage Association

A major factor in Woodrow Wilson's victory in the 1912 presidential campaign was the fact that:

the Republican party had split in two

The first place in the United States to extend equal voting rights to women was:

the Wyoming Territory

Progressives supported all of the following as measures to democratize government EXCEPT:

the poll tax

The phrase "Square Deal" is associated with Theodore Roosevelt.

true

In the area of conservation, Theodore Roosevelt:

used the Forest Reserve Act to withdraw over 170 million acres of timberland from logging

Louis D. Brandeis:

was the first Jewish member of the Supreme Court
